Who is Julie Grant?

Julie Grant is an American licensed attorney, former prosecutor, trial expert, and journalist. She contributes to Court TV with a lethal combination of legal knowledge and journalism experience.

She has taught at Temple University’s highly respected LL.M. program and is a faculty member at the National Center for Trial Advocacy, earning her the nickname “The Professor” from her Court TV coworkers.

Julie is a journalist who has won awards, and her fans know that she truly cares about crime victims. You can watch Court TV Live on weekdays from 12 pm-3 pm ET.

Julie Grant Education

Grant received her Juris Doctor from the University of Akron School of Law and her LL.M. in trial advocacy with Honors from Temple University School of Law. She also graduated from Mount Union College with a B.A. in Mass Communication as well.

Julie Grant Court TV

Julie Grant is a host of the new Court TV. She contributes a good combination of legal knowledge and journalism experience to the renowned brand that was revived in May 2019.

She handled a variety of felonies and minor cases in Allegheny County, Pennsylvania (Pittsburgh), in the presence of judges and juries. As of 2023, she likes teaching trial advocacy.

She has conducted exclusive interviews with Dr. Maya Angelou, a literary and civil rights hero, renowned criminal defense lawyer F. Lee Bailey, renowned forensic pathologist Dr. Cyril Wecht, and Olympic gold medalist Kurt Angle.

Julie was able to follow her enthusiasm for dancing to a high level by cheerleading for the NHL’s Pittsburgh Penguins before combining her love for journalism and law. She now focuses her work on Court TV Live, which airs weekdays from 12 to 3 p.m. EST.

Fans of Court TV are familiar with Julie’s sincere kindness and empathy, which she often expresses to victims on the network designed for true crime.

Julie is a member of the advisory board for the nationally acclaimed Paws for Empowerment program at Crisis Center North in Western Pennsylvania because she sincerely cares about the advocacy of victims.

The program’s canine court advocates give treatment during individual counseling sessions and accompany victims of domestic violence to criminal court hearings.
